Property Insights of N-tert-Butoxycarbonyl-L-tryptophan

The XLogP value of 2.0 suggests moderate lipophilicity, balancing water solubility and membrane permeability for N-tert-Butoxycarbonyl-L-tryptophan. The TPSA of 91.4 Ų falls within the moderate polarity range, balancing permeability and solubility for N-tert-Butoxycarbonyl-L-tryptophan. Following Lipinski's Rule of Five, N-tert-Butoxycarbonyl-L-tryptophan has 3 hydrogen bond donor(s) and 4 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
